At the Hollister volleyball tournament, Reeds Spring High School placed third. Emma Thompson and Brooke Fuller were named to the All-Tournament team. Earlier in the week, the Lady Wolves beat Springfield Catholic 3-1, lost to Hillcrest 3-1, and lost to Strafford 3-0.
Girls Golf
At the Clever Invitational, RSHS finished third out of 20 schools. Saylor Johnson finished sixth, shooting an 81. Lyla Mackie had the closest to the pin shot. The JV team competed in the Mid-Lakes Conference Scramble. Emilee Coleman and Kourtney Stice finished third.

Football
The Wolves lost to Forsyth 41-14. Kaden Evans had a rushing touchdown and a touchdown pass to Brody Bekebrede. Aiden Wohletz added two extra points.
Cross Country
At Republic, the Wolves finished second as a team. Max Hirschi was second overall, Connor Love fourth, Ronnie Jo Clouse 15th, Dane Thierbach 17th, and Brody McIntosh 22nd. For the girls, Grace Johnson placed 18th, Claire Ross 24th, and Katelyn Houtz 29th. At Nixa, Love placed eighth, Hirschi 11th, and Clouse 25th. The boys placed third overall.
